The Work
The position is for an experienced Systems Engineer Lead who will provide leadership and guidance for activities on the MH-60 Naval Helicopter Program. In this role you will:
- Lead and coordinate with a complex, multidisciplinary team of engineers
- You will contribute to system design and requirements development, ensuring system architectures, interfaces, and behaviors align with customer and program needs.
- Support major program reviews including SRR, PDR, and CDR
- Develop Basis of Estimates for United States Navy contract proposal(s)
- Act as a Control Account Manager, performing all necessary aspects in Earned Value Management reporting
- Communicate technical status and program progress to internal leadership and external customers.
Please note:
This position is based in Owego, NY.
This position requires the ability to obtain and maintain a Secret-level government security clearance (U.S. citizenship required).

Basic Qualifications
Experience collaborating and leading a diverse set multi-functional teams
Broad systems engineering experience (e.g. system architecture and design, systems documentation, system requirements, CONOPS, systems verification)
Control Account Management (CAM) and/or Earned Value Management (EVMS) experience.
Bachelor's degree in Electrical, Systems Engineering, Computer Engineering, Mathematics or related STEM discipline from an accredited college with at least 5+ years of relevant experience.
This position requires the ability to obtain and maintain a DoD government clearance at the Secret level
Desired Skills
Experience throughout engineering lifecycle (system definition, design, build, test, and operational deployment)
Experience with Model Based Systems Engineering (MBSE) tools (e.g., SysML, Cameo)
Experience with leading and managing engineering product lines
Familiarity with MH60 CONOPS, Architecture, and Requirements
Current active Secret security clearance
